Crestron DigitalMedia Card
October 26, 2009The new DMCI (DigitalMedia Card Interface) solution is a compact, rack-mountable enclosure designed to house a single DM Input Card to accept any AV source, including all analog audio and video, computer, HDMI, DVI and DisplayPort signals, and output those signals as HDMI.
DMCI even handles USB-HID over Ethernet for remote wireless keyboard/mouse control and USB-HID signals and output those signals as HDMI. DMCI manages HDCP, EDID and CEC data communication, and functions as a DM receiver as part of a complete Crestron DigitalMedia™ system. Ideal for Home theaters, classrooms and conference rooms.
